Key Takeaways: Bogotá vs Shanghai

Overall, Bogotá is approximately 50% cheaper than Shanghai based on our cost of living index. Bogotá has a COLI of 22.9 (ranked #103 of 182 cities), while Shanghai has a COLI of 46.2 (ranked #60).

When it comes to housing, one-bedroom apartment rent in Bogotá averages $400/month compared to $1,100/month in Shanghai. That makes Bogotá approximately 64% cheaper for rent alone.

Bogotá has lower total deductions (14.7%) compared to Shanghai (35.2%), meaning you keep more of your gross salary in Bogotá. When evaluating a relocation, remember that total deductions directly impact your take-home pay and should be weighed alongside cost of living differences.

Data Sources & Methodology

Cost of living indices (COLI) are benchmarked to New York City = 100 and derived from Numbeo and Expatistan crowd-sourced price surveys, cross-referenced with national statistics agencies. Rent data from Numbeo Property Prices.

Salary ranges are compiled from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(OES), Glassdoor, and PayScale. Tax rates are approximate effective rates for mid-range earners based on OECD Taxing Wages and national tax authorities. Exchange rates from the European Central Bank. Neighborhood multipliers are estimated from local rental indices and property data.
